Learn about CVE-2020-11181, a Qualcomm Snapdragon vulnerability allowing out-of-bound access due to improper buffer pointer validation. Find mitigation steps and affected systems here.
A vulnerability in Qualcomm Snapdragon processors could allow an attacker to perform out-of-bound access due to improper validation of buffer pointers.
Understanding CVE-2020-11181
This CVE involves an untrusted pointer dereference issue in ComputerVision, affecting various Snapdragon product lines.
What is CVE-2020-11181?
The vulnerability arises from mishandling cvp process control commands, leading to out-of-bound access due to inadequate validation of buffer pointers received from the High-Level Operating System (HLOS).
The Impact of CVE-2020-11181
The vulnerability could be exploited by a malicious actor to execute arbitrary code, potentially compromising the affected devices' security and integrity.
Technical Details of CVE-2020-11181
Qualcomm Snapdragon processors are affected by this vulnerability, impacting multiple product lines and versions.
Vulnerability Description
The issue stems from improper validation of buffer pointers received from HLOS, allowing unauthorized access to memory locations.
Affected Systems and Versions
Exploitation Mechanism
The vulnerability can be exploited by crafting malicious cvp process control commands to trigger out-of-bound access and potentially execute arbitrary code.
Mitigation and Prevention
To address CVE-2020-11181, follow these steps:
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ates